| 3.3 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 7/10 | 3/5 | 7/10 | 3/5 | 13/20 | Jun 23, 2008 500 ml bottle from LCBO, served cold in a Weizen glass. JN17/08.
App.: Cloudy brown-amber with a decent off-white head.
Aroma: Spicey – clove and cinnamon, yeasty with less of the typical banana esters, fruity – raisins, apricots and cherries.
Palate: Medium body, moderate effervescence with some sharp bubbles, slightly astringent.
Flav.: Slightly nutty, lots of cloves and cinnamon, banana esters, some raisins and other fruits; fairly dry with a light clove finish.
